What were two major shortcomings of Mendeleev periodic table?

What were two major shortcomings of Mendeleev periodic table? State two limitations of Mendeleev Periodic Table Elements with large differences in properties were included in the same group. Are 2s and 2p degenerate?

Are 2s and 2p degenerate? The 2s and 2p orbitals have the same energy for hydrogen. They are said to be degenerate energy levels, all the same. When the electron is held in the 1s orbital, it is said to be in its ground state, its lowest energy state. When the electron is a higher […]
